No, you would just need to know which files require updates for your needs. Updates are like telephone calls, they don't have to be accepted. 

In fact as a general practice, its usually recommended not to update stuff you don't particularly need to use or you don't understand, in order to minimize the chances of breaking something you do understand and use.

I don't get it, what's so hard about choosing which packages to download opportunistically for later offline installation? dpkg and apt all have query tools to use to sort out dependency issues.

What if he wants to air gap a node of a  trusted network for data security reasons?

Businesses do that sort of thing all the time in order to protect their trade secrets from snoops and scrapes and spooks.
